Whole House Fan Installation in Orem, UT
Whole house fan installation involves setting up a ventilation system designed to improve airflow throughout a residence. These fans are typically installed in the attic and work by drawing cooler outdoor air into the home while exhausting warmer indoor air, helping to reduce indoor temperatures and improve air quality. Projects often include homes seeking to enhance natural ventilation, reduce reliance on air conditioning, or improve overall indoor comfort during warmer months. Property owners interested in this service should consider factors such as attic space, existing ventilation, and the home's layout to determine if a whole house fan is a suitable solution.
Before requesting installation, homeowners usually want to understand the size and capacity of the fan needed for their specific property, as well as any modifications required to accommodate the system. It’s also important to consider how the fan will integrate with existing ventilation and insulation, and whether additional features like timers or thermostats are desired. Proper installation ensures optimal performance and energy efficiency, making it beneficial for property owners to discuss these aspects with professionals experienced in whole house fan systems.

Whole House Fan Installation Questions
What is a whole house fan? A whole house fan is a ventilation system that cools a home by pulling in outside air and exhausting indoor air, helping reduce indoor temperatures efficiently.
How does a whole house fan benefit a home? It improves air circulation, reduces reliance on air conditioning, and promotes indoor comfort during warmer months.
Where is a whole house fan installed? Typically, it is installed in the attic or ceiling to facilitate effective airflow throughout the entire home.
What types of homes are suitable for whole house fan installation? Most single-family homes with attic access can accommodate a whole house fan for improved ventilation.
